The Congress has won one of its biggest victories in Karnataka. The BJP meanwhile faced one of its biggest routs. What led to the BJP losing its southern bastion? Few BJP insiders have said that the party had diluted its core ideology. The import of leaders from other parties who did not agree with the BJP's core ideology had resulted in the Karyakartas being confused on the ground as each leader had taken different stance on issues. BJP spokesperson Vaman Acharya has written an editorial in the Indian Exporess saying the BJP had nothing to showcase in terms of development. He added that corruption too had become a major sticking point and the party did very little to address the issue. The campaign run by the Congress against CM Bommai stuck resulting in the narrative that the BJP had corrupt leaders.
